CheetahFlow: Towards Low Latency Software-Defined Network

被引:0
|
作者
Su, Zhiyang [1 ]
Wang, Ting [1 ]
Xia, Yu [1 ]
Hamdi, Mounir [1 ]
机构
[1] Hong Kong Univ Sci & Technol, Dept Comp Sci & Engn, Hong Kong, Hong Kong, Peoples R China
关键词
D O I
暂无
中图分类号
TN [电子技术、通信技术];
学科分类号
0809 ;
摘要
Software defined networking (SDN), which enables programmability, has the advantage of global visibility and high flexibility. However, when forwarding new flows in SDN, the interaction between the switch and the controller imposes extra latency such as round-trip time and routing path search time. Even though such latency is acceptable for elephant flows since it only takes limited ratio of total transmission time of elephant flows, it is an overkill to pay certain overheads for mice flows due to the their short transmission time. Moreover, the controller is frequently invoked by the mice flows since the number of mice flows accounts for a large portion of the total number of flows. Hence, the frequent controller invocation is mainly responsible for the controller performance degradation, and thus increasing the flow setup latency significantly. To solve this problem, we propose CheetahFlow, a novel scheme to predict frequent communication pairs via support vector machine and proactively setup wildcard rules to reduce flow setup latency. Particularly, in order to avoid congestion along a fixed path, elephant flows are detected and rerouted to the non-congestion path efficiently by applying blocking island paradigm. Extensive experiments show that CheetahFlow prominently reduces latency without any loss of flexibility of SDN.
引用
收藏
页码:3076 / 3081
页数:6
相关论文
共 50 条
  • [31] Towards Software-Defined VANET: Architecture and Services
    Ku, Ian
    Lu, You
    Gerla, Mario
    Ongaro, Francesco
    Gomes, Rafael L.
    Cerqueira, Eduardo
    2014 13TH ANNUAL MEDITERRANEAN AD HOC NETWORKING WORKSHOP (MED-HOC-NET), 2014,
  • [32] Towards an Accountable Software-Defined Networking Architecture
    Ujcich, Benjamin E.
    Miller, Andrew
    Bates, Adam
    Sanders, William H.
    2017 IEEE CONFERENCE ON NETWORK SOFTWARIZATION (IEEE NETSOFT), 2017,
  • [33] Towards Software-Defined Delay Tolerant Networks
    Ta, Dominick
    Booth, Stephanie
    Dudukovich, Rachel
    NETWORK, 2023, 3 (01): : 15 - 38
  • [34] Towards a reliable firewall for software-defined networks
    Hu, Hongxin
    Han, Wonkyu
    Kyung, Sukwha
    Wang, Juan
    Ahn, Gail-Joon
    Zhao, Ziming
    Li, Hongda
    COMPUTERS & SECURITY, 2019, 87
  • [35] Low-Latency Software Defined Network for High Performance Clouds
    Rad, Paul
    Boppana, Rajendra V.
    Lama, Palden
    Berman, Gilad
    Jamshidi, Mo
    2015 10TH SYSTEM OF SYSTEMS ENGINEERING CONFERENCE (SOSE), 2015, : 486 - 491
  • [36] Latency-Aware Power Management in Software-Defined Radios
    Malm, Nicolas
    Ruttik, Kalle
    Tirkkonen, Olav
    JOURNAL OF ELECTRICAL AND COMPUTER ENGINEERING, 2020, 2020
  • [37] Towards Software-Defined Optical Network: From the Perspective of Heterogeneous Optical Networks
    Zhou, Yu
    Huang, Shanguo
    Li, Wenzhe
    Yin, Shan
    Zhang, Jie
    Gu, Wanyi
    2015 OPTO-ELECTRONICS AND COMMUNICATIONS CONFERENCE (OECC), 2015,
  • [38] Towards controller placement problem for software-defined network using affinity propagation
    Zhao, Jianlong
    Qu, Hua
    Zhao, Jihong
    Luan, Zhirong
    Guo, Ya
    ELECTRONICS LETTERS, 2017, 53 (14) : 928 - 929
  • [39] Low-Latency PON PHY Implementation on GPUs for Fully Software-Defined Access Networks
    Suzuki, Takahiro
    Kim, Sang-Yuep
    Kani, Jun-ichi
    Yoshida, Tomoaki
    IEEE NETWORK, 2022, 36 (02): : 108 - 114
  • [40] Multi-mode Low-latency Software-defined Error Correction for Data Centers
    Ghaffari, Fakhreddine
    Akoglu, Ali
    Vasic, Bane
    Declercq, David
    2017 26TH INTERNATIONAL CONFERENCE ON COMPUTER COMMUNICATION AND NETWORKS (ICCCN 2017), 2017,